Adidas Yamamoto Y-3 Japan 2024 Home, Away & Goalkeeper Kits Released

  • Collaboration: The Japan 2024 home, away, and goalkeeper kits are a collaboration between Adidas and Yohji Yamamoto's Y-3 brand.
  • Design Theme: All three kits feature flame graphics, meant to represent the strength of the Japanese team and the mystique of Japan.
  • Release Date: The kits will be available for purchase starting June 22nd, and the women's national team will debut them on July 13th.

The Japan national team on Friday afternoon officially presented the new 2024 home, away and goalkeeper kits, created through a collaboration between kit supplier Adidas and Japanese fashion designer Yohji Yamamoto under the Y-3 name.

The Japan 2024 home, away and third jerseys will be available from June 22. The Japan women's national team will debut the new uniforms in a game against Ghana on July 13.

The Yamamoto Japan 2024 home, away and goalkeeper kits all feature the Y-3 logo in place of the Adidas logo, and share a theme of flame graphics, inspired by the "unwavering strength of the Japan National Football Team and the mysterious power of the country of Japan."

Japan 2024 Home Kit

This picture shows the Japan 2024 home jersey, made by Adidas and designed by Yohji Yamamoto.

The Adidas Y-3 Japanese national football team 2024 home football shirt returns to a navy main color. This is the first time since 2018 that the Japan kit does not feature a bright blue.

What makes the Adidas Japan 2024 home kit is a bright blue fiery design on the front.

This design even continues on the shorts, which have the same color as the shirt.

Japan 2024 Away Kit

This picture shows the Japan 2024 away jersey, made by Adidas and designed by Yohji Yamamoto.

The new Japan 2024 away football jersey has a main color of 'Clear White' combined with a red flame graphic that burns on the right side of the shirt.

Both the Y-3 logo and the Japan crest are placed in the center, as with the home kit.

White shorts and socks complete the kit.

Japan 2024 Goalkeeper Kit

This is the new Japan 2024 GK home shirt, made by Adidas Y-3.

The Yamamoto Japan 2024 goalkeeper jersey has a main Matcha color with a burning flame pattern on the back of the jersey that spills over to the front of the jersey.

The Adidas Japan 2024 home, away & goalkeeper football shirts will be available to buy from June 22.

AS Saint-Étienne 1976 European Cup Final Remake Kit Revealed

Exactly 50 years to the day after the famous European Cup final in Glasgow, Le Coq Sportif has released a special limited-edition reissue of the iconic AS Saint-Étienne 1976 kit. Paying tribute to the legendary Dominique Rocheteau, the brand has meticulously reproduced his number 7 jersey directly from their Romilly-sur-Seine workshops. The retro green shirt faithfully maintains the original cut, material, and classic blue-white-red tricolor collar of the era.

The limited collection is available soon via the official Le Coq Sportif web store. It features a long-sleeved version retailing for €110, a short-sleeved option for €89, and a matching track jacket priced at €190.
